首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

CSS各种图形(五角星、吃豆人、太极图等)

这里说用css做图形,其实是使用一个html元素,结合它伪元素 ::before & ::after (不需要其他额外非伪元素html元素),然后定义样式来生成所需图形。...这里不是说不可以使用其它html元素,只是这样好处是在html方便引入,而不需要每次引入都需要添加大量html片段(夸张说法)。可以先预览演示地址 ?...::after) 和上面样式属性中一种或几种随机组合。...当然,在前端我们经常使用时svg和font-icon。 还用一种是css3shape-outside实现文本环绕效果。 下面主要介绍第一种。...) 等边三角形(箭头朝上) 等边三角形(箭头朝下) 等边三角形(箭头朝左) 等边三角形(箭头朝右) 矩形形 正方形 正五边形 正六边形 正七边形 正八边形 平行四边形 圆形 椭圆形 梯形 扇形 星形 五角星

2K20

Android studio 实现随机位置10个随机大小五角星代码

Android studio:实现随机位置10个随机大小五角星今天做了一下老师布置实验课作业安卓作业。实现在屏幕上随机位置绘制10个随机大小五角星。...先开始五角星画法,通过translate(x,y)方法来改变起点位置,使用rotate()方法进行笔锋转角。...五角星画出去了?这是为什么,我就开始找呀找,然后发现是因为我画笔坐标的位置改了,没有改回来,画下一个五角星时候就会把之前坐标当成(0,0)。...这个可怎么办呀,我想到了一种方式就是打破思路,重新用一种方式,用数学来计算五角星每一笔起点和终点。这个方法不会出现画出去情况(数值合理)。...总结 到此这篇关于Android studio 实现随机位置10个随机大小五角星文章就介绍到这了,更多相关Android studio 实现随机位置10个随机大小五角星内容请搜索ZaLou.Cn

1K81

美国队长盾(二)五角星

今天我们接着铸造美国队长盾牌。 ? 前面我们已经把四个同心圆画好了(美国队长盾(一) 同心圆),就缺“画龙点睛”之笔五角星了。那么今天我们就来纯手工打造这样一个五角星。...要这样一个五角星,有些长度和角度还是需要计算一下。 比如说五角星顶角为36°,完一条边需要旋转角度等等。具体计算方法可以参考上面这张纯手工打造示意图。...看上去还真有一点按照工程图纸来铸造意思。 我不知道大家是怎么来五角星,我习惯是五条边,每次旋转36°。就是下面这个示意图。 ?...那就五个等腰三角形来构成这个五角星。酱紫~ ? 那么问题来了,等腰三角形变长是多少。假设外接圆半径是r,那么红色线段长度应该为r*cos54。..., 'red') # 第四个圆 circle(bob, r - 3 * step, 'blue') # 五角星 star(bob, r - 3 * step, 'white

1.1K20

有趣python代码_python五角星代码

大家好,又见面了,我是你们朋友全栈君。 原标题:使用Python代码程序员也浪漫 代码也浪漫:用Python放一场圣诞节烟花秀! 天天敲代码朋友,有没有想过代码也可以变得很酷炫又浪漫?...它们能让我们更容易控制烟花粒子运动轨迹。...该Label调用中第一个参数就是父窗口名字,即我们这里用“根”。关键字参数“text”指明显示文字内容。你也可以调用其它小部件:Button,Canvas等等。...w.pack root.mainloop 接下来这两行代码很重要。这里打包方法是告诉Tkinter调整窗口大小以适应所用小部件。...该函数会展示所有的数据项,并根据我们设置时间更新每个数据项属性。在我们主代码中,我们会用一个alarm处理模块after调用此函数,after会等待一定时间,然后再调用函数。

1.4K10

Python|画一面国旗

问题描述 既然要用python画一面国旗,首先就能想到用python中图画库俗称小海龟,也就是老朋友turtle,之前爱心时也用到它。...解决方案 首先知道turtle画图时基于一个二维坐标系中,所以要画像国旗庄严而又神圣图形,自然要严格要求尺寸以及坐标,特别是几颗五角星坐标必须经过严格计算,当然这个步骤就需要在纸上找出坐标了...(1)先画出国旗框架,也就是背景红面。 (2)然后画出其中最大五角星。这里爱心采用for循环。 (3)调好每个小五角星大小及坐标顺序画出。 (4)最后再隐藏画笔并让停留。...这样一面好看又爱国国旗就画好了。 ? 图 1 国旗效果图 ? 图 1 五角星代码

1.2K40

EA中状态转换图如何,就是那种曲线

robotsky(872***689) 15:48:40 EA中状态转换图如何,就是那种曲线。...潘加宇(3504847) 10:58:38 群共享文件有之前上传EA 12状态机操作教程:StatemachineEA12.pdf 潘加宇(3504847) 10:59:07 如果要改变连接线风格,右击...robotsky(872***689) 09:32:56 EA中如何这种图 robotsky(872***689) 09:34:31 就是在哪个模式中才能以这种优美的弧线。...一般来说,超过三种以上状态,就需要分拆一下了。 言真[Mars](52***52) 10:52:51 过多节点放到一起,很大程度上是因为边界不够清晰。...潘加宇(3504847) 07:52:10 参见群文件 StatemachineEA12.pdf 潘加宇(3504847) 07:53:44 可以考虑把同一事件不同源状态合并到组合状态

1.7K20

python与分形0015 - 【教程】五星红旗

国旗和数学 在国旗之前,我们需要弄清楚国旗图形结构。...中华人民共和国国旗红色象征革命。旗上五颗五角星及其相互关系象征共产党领导下革命人民大团结。...开始画图 先来旗面,是一个简单矩形,其思路很简单: 从左上顶点开始,往东,seth(0),走30L长度。 再往南,seth(-90),走20L长度。...我们观察到五角星边具有可复制性,A-C1-B重复5次即可,那么我们先把A-C1-B画出来。 先不要下笔,从O出发,向北,seth(90),走L长度,现在在A点。...这时,我们发现,绘图过程中,五角星角度在down之前就已经调整好了,后面5条折线时候都是相对位置。

78040

手把手教你Python圣诞主题绘图

绘制圣诞五角星 利用turtle库绘制一个橙黄色五角星 整体布局和文字 将绘制元素整合,完成整体布局 使用turtle库write函数添加"Merry Christmas"文字 绘制结束 使用turtle...五角星绘制 通过turtle库绘图功能,实现了一个橙黄色五角星,为圣诞主题画面锦上添花。...t.screensize(800,600, "black") left(90) forward(3 * n) color("orange", "yellow") begin_fill() left(126) #五角星...定义彩灯函数drawlight(): 如果随机数在范围0, 30中,设置彩灯颜色为'tomato',并画一个半径为6圆。...雪花,使用六个线段模拟五角星形状。 初始化一些变量,包括分支长度n、编码方式、背景颜色等。 t.pensize(10): 设置画笔宽度。

1.2K30

Python生成高级圣诞树-代码案例剖析

turtle.right(144):向右旋转144度,绘制五角星一个角。 重复上述两步三次,绘制五个角。 turtle.left(72):向左旋转72度,准备绘制下一个五角星。...,外圈是orange,内部是yellow begin_fill() left(126) for i in range(5): #五角星 forward(n/5) right(144...) #五角星角度 forward(n/5) left(72) #继续换角度 end_fill() right(126) def drawlight():#定义彩灯方法...right(144):向右旋转144度,绘制五角星一个角。 forward(n/5):继续向前移动五分之一分支长度。 left(72):向左旋转72度,准备绘制下一个五角星。...提起画笔,移动到新位置。 雪花,使用六个线段模拟五角星形状。 drawsnow():调用drawsnow方法。 t.done():完成绘图。 圣诞节快乐!

2K80

python等边三角形_四边形画法

在学Python时候,无意间看到网上有小游戏开发,于是乎就想自己调试下。第一个接触例程是国旗。...国旗必然要画框,画框也就是四边形,要五角星,而五角星就是也是由三角形组成,因此画一面很完美的五星红旗,则基础需要四边形和三角形。OK,让我们一起来玩下吧。...import turtle import time # 调用turtle中Pen函数创建画布 t = turtle.Pen() # 矩形 for i in range(0, 4): # 往前画一条直线...t.forward(100) # 左转弯90度 t.left(90) time.sleep(3) #time.sleep(3) # 清空画布并把海龟放在起始位置 t.reset() # 两条相互平行直线...# 往前移动20个像素 t.forward(20) # 左转90度,指向和上一条线平行方向 t.left(90) time.sleep(3) # 放下画笔,开始作画 t.down() # 另一条平行线

97840
领券